Παρασκευή, 31 Ιανουαρίου, 2025

Ελεύθερο Λογισμικό στην Εκπαίδευση

Ισως η πλέον προοδευτική σκοπιά του ΕΛ/ΛΑΚ είναι η συνεισφορά του στην Εκπαίδευση.
Χρησιμοποιώντας λογισμικό ανοικτού κώδικα στην εκπαιδευτική διαδικασία προσαρμόζουμε το λογισμικό στις ανάγκες της Εκπαίδευσης, αντιδιαμετρικά με τη χρήση του κλειστού λογισμικού, που έχουμε προσαρμογή της Εκπαίδευσης στις ιδιαιτερότητες του λογισμικού!
Αρχικά, η αλληλεπίδραση χρηστών – δημιουργών δημιουργεί μια σχέση ανάδρασης, που συντελεί στη συνεχή βελτιστοποίηση του λογισμικού, στην καλλιέργεια κλίματος συναδελφικότητας μεταξύ των μελών της κοινότητας που το χρησιμοποιούν και στη διεπιστημονική ανάπτυξη των εμπλεκόμενων. Ετσι η εκπαιδευτική διαδικασία μπορεί να γίνει πιο δημιουργική και πιο προσοδοφόρα.
Ιδιάζοντα ρόλο έχει το ΕΛ/ΛΑΚ στις σπουδές Πληροφορικής. Με τη χρήση λογισμικού ανοικτού κώδικα ο διδασκόμενος εντρυφεί έμπρακτα στο αντικείμενο που σπουδάζει, αφού του δίνεται πλέον η δυνατότητα να έχει την πρόσβαση στον πηγαίο κώδικα των εργαλείων που χρησιμοποιεί. Γνωρίζει έτσι εις βάθος το αντικείμενό του και ταυτόχρονα μπορεί να το εφαρμόζει καθώς εμπνέεται από δημιουργίες άλλων προγραμματιστών, δανείζεται κομμάτια κώδικα ή εργαλεία και αναλίσκεται στην περαιτέρω ανάπτυξη αυτών ή δικών του δημιουργημάτων αντί να προσπαθεί να ξανα – εφεύρει τον τροχό. Η δυνατότητα που δίνεται στον μαθητή να είναι ταυτόχρονα και δημιουργός τον εισαγάγει σιγά – σιγά στον χώρο της εργασίας μέσω της δημιουργικότερης πτυχής της.
Επιπλέον, με τη διάδοση του ΕΛ/ΛΑΚ δίνεται η δυνατότητα σε νεαρούς guru των υπολογιστών να αρχίζουν να πειραματίζονται με αυτό, χωρίς τους φραγμούς που επιβάλλει το κλειστό λογισμικό και χωρίς να είναι τόσο αποκλειστικά αναγκαία η συνδρομή κάποιου εκπαιδευτικού. Επίσης, δίνεται η δυνατότητα σε ανθρώπους που δεν έχουν σπουδάσει Πληροφορική να έρθουν πιο κοντά με το αντικείμενο του λογισμικού και να ανακαλύψουν τον δημιουργικό και αειφόρο χαρακτήρα του προγραμματισμού.
Η ακαδημαϊκή σημασία του να υιοθετηθεί το ελεύθερο λογισμικό είναι ακόμα πιο καίρια. Με τη χρήση λογισμικού ανοικτού κώδικα ο διδασκόμενος εντρυφεί έμπρακτα στο αντικείμενο που σπουδάζει αφού του δίνεται πλέον η δυνατότητα να έχει την πρόσβαση στον πηγαίο κώδικα των εργαλείων που χρησιμοποιεί. Μέσω της κοινοτικής, ελεύθερης ανάπτυξης του λογισμικού μπορούν να δοθούν στ? αλήθεια νέες δυνατότητες εκμάθησης της Πληροφορικής και άμεσης αλληλεπίδρασης των εργαζομένων με το αντικείμενο της εργασίας τους. Αντί, λοιπόν, να ενισχυθεί η αλλοτρίωση από το αντικείμενο δουλειάς, η τεχνοφοβία και η επιβολή της κυριαρχίας στη γνώση από τα μονοπώλια και ενώ οι δυνατότητες που διανοίγονται από τη σκοπιά της ελευθερίας της γνώσης και της εργασίας είναι ασύγκριτες, είναι μονόδρομος η σύγκρουση με τους εγχώριους καλοθελητές και υπαλλήλους των επιχειρήσεων και με τις λογικές που εκπροσωπούν. 

Ενδεικτικές Χρήσεις του Ελεύθερου Λογισμικού
Ελεύθερο λογισμικό έχει χρησιμοποιηθεί σε πλέον εξεζητημένα πεδία εφαρμογών με μεγάλη επιτυχία. Εντελώς ενδεικτικά μερικά παραδείγματα αναφέρονται παρακάτω:
*OLPC (one laptop per child = ένα λάπτοπ για κάθε παιδί). Η χρήση του Linux ως λογισμικό σύστημα βοήθησε τον Ελληνοαμερικάνο καθηγητή, Ν. Νεγρεπόντη, να κρατήσει χαμηλά την τιμή του ´λάπτοπ των 100 δολαρίων´
*EPICS(ExperimentalPhysicsandIndustrial Control System) που χρησιμοποιείται στον ITER (Διεθνής θερμοπυρηνικός αντιδραστήρας), όπου επιχειρείται η εκμετάλλευση της ενέργειας, που αποδεσμεύεται κατά την πυρηνική σύντηξη.
*´Oscar project´: Είναι ένα πρόγραμμα για τη σχεδίαση αυτοκινήτου με λογισμικό ανοικτού κώδικα. Ξεκίνησε στη Γερμανία και αναπτύχθηκε ώστε να ενσωματώσει και Αμερικανούς επαγγελματίες σχεδιαστές. (Οι οποίοι κάποια στιγμή σταμάτησαν τη συμμετοχή τους. Στην αρχή στο site ανέφεραν ότι έπρεπε να σταματήσουν χωρίς να μπορούν να πουν οτιδήποτε άλλο. Αργότερα, ανακοίνωσαν ότι θα επιστρέψουν στις αρχές του 2004 χωρίς, όμως, να το πράξουν.)
*Τα συστήματα κατανεμημένης επεξεργασίας πληροφορίας (grid computing). Επειδή στις μέρες μας ο όγκος των πληροφοριών που καλούνται να επεξεργαστούν διάφορα υπολογιστικά συστήματα είναι τεράστιος, η επεξεργασία αυτών καταμερίζεται σε πολλά τερματικά που επεξεργάζονται τα δεδομένα παράλληλα. Και σε αυτόν τον τομέα τα καταφέρνουν περίφημα το Linux και τα υπόλοιπα λειτουργικά συστήματα οικογένειας Unix. Εχουν, μάλιστα, δημιουργηθεί και διανομές ειδικές γι? αυτόν τον σκοπό(Red hat Cluster).

Ομάδα ΕΛ/ΛΑΚ Πολυτεχνείου Κρήτης


Ακολουθήστε τα Χανιώτικα Νέα στο Google News στο Facebook και στο Twitter.

Δημοφιλή άρθρα

Αφήστε ένα σχόλιο

Please enter your comment!
Please enter your name here

Μικρές αγγελίες

aggelies

Βήμα στον αναγνώστη

Στείλτε μας φωτό και video ή κάντε μία καταγγελία

Συμπληρώστε τη φόρμα

Ειδήσεις

Χρήσιμα